quote arguments passed to scripts

partially fixes build with space(s) in directories

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
This commit is contained in:
Ivailo Monev 2021-09-06 20:57:16 +03:00
parent ba65b3e586
commit 095acdcef0
4 changed files with 6 additions and 6 deletions

View file

@ -14,4 +14,4 @@ bin="$1"
shift
cd "$(dirname "$bin")"
exec gdb --args "./$(basename "$bin")" $@
exec gdb --args "./$(basename "$bin")" "$@"

View file

@ -15,6 +15,6 @@ shift
cd "$(dirname "$bin")"
if [ -z "$DBUS_SESSION_BUS_ADDRESS" ];then
exec dbus-run-session -- @CMAKE_CROSSCOMPILING_EMULATOR@ "./$(basename "$bin")" $@
exec dbus-run-session -- @CMAKE_CROSSCOMPILING_EMULATOR@ "./$(basename "$bin")" "$@"
fi
exec @CMAKE_CROSSCOMPILING_EMULATOR@ "./$(basename "$bin")" $@
exec @CMAKE_CROSSCOMPILING_EMULATOR@ "./$(basename "$bin")" "$@"

View file

@ -14,4 +14,4 @@ bin="$1"
shift
cd "$(dirname "$bin")"
exec @CMAKE_CROSSCOMPILING_EMULATOR@ "./$(basename "$bin")" $@
exec @CMAKE_CROSSCOMPILING_EMULATOR@ "./$(basename "$bin")" "$@"

View file

@ -20,9 +20,9 @@ if [ -z "$DISPLAY" ];then
sleep 5
retval=0
DISPLAY=:123 @CMAKE_CROSSCOMPILING_EMULATOR@ "./$(basename "$bin")" $@ || retval=$?
DISPLAY=:123 @CMAKE_CROSSCOMPILING_EMULATOR@ "./$(basename "$bin")" "$@" || retval=$?
kill $xvfbpid
exit $retval
fi
exec @CMAKE_CROSSCOMPILING_EMULATOR@ "./$(basename "$bin")" $@
exec @CMAKE_CROSSCOMPILING_EMULATOR@ "./$(basename "$bin")" "$@"